Transaction 8a952f89f1326d46333955434540f26dab3c6bed2c78e78e9ac2771182020364
1 Input
1 Output
-
8a952f89f1326d46333955434540f26dab3c6bed2c78e78e9ac2771182020364:0
- value
- 66220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7c774a896b67fa0cb7bbca294f2e4f951be64e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LfwDfmLvzohVvvQ2W7PmoxDb3qgxWuCvH